Transaction 8506550c2f25d155357f83c9954d9412bd0a26c1d28c280c616685220a6bf884
1 Input
1 Output
-
8506550c2f25d155357f83c9954d9412bd0a26c1d28c280c616685220a6bf884:0
- value
- 896093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98cc14e3c6ad73d56835a95927b7259477896e94 OP_EQUAL
- address
- 3Fcw7YHQQkTNVbEs9Vorim8ghozFtAStq2